NFFE Praises Biden Administration Picks for the Federal Service Impasses Panel (FSIP)

The Biden Administration announced the intended appointment of 10 new members to the Federal Service Impasses Panel (FSIP) – a group charged with resolving disputes when an impasse is reached between unions and government agencies during labor-management negotiations.

NFFE Hails Bipartisan Fed Retirement Fairness Act, Providing Long Overdue Retirement Security for Former Temporary and Seasonal Federal Employees

Rep. Derek Kilmer (D-WA) and Rep. Tom Cole (R-OK) have introduced the Federal Retirement Fairness Act. The bill will allow former seasonal and temporary federal employees the option to ‘buy-back’ retirement contributions to retire on time.
